Oxford United will be looking to bounce back from Saturday’s defeat at Doncaster when they travel to Bristol Rovers on Tuesday night.

The defeat ended a club-record nine game winning run and halted a stretch of 13 games unbeaten for the U’s. Karl Robinson‘s side will be looking to bounce back against a Rovers team that have failed to win in their last nine games in all competitions.

Of that run, Rovers have lost seven – including a 2-0 defeat to the U’s – with the other two games ending in goalless draws. Former Rovers striker Matty Taylor netted a brace for the U’s in the previous meeting.

The defeat at Doncaster saw the U’s drop one place to 11th but are now six points off the playoffs. A goalless draw at Fleetwood, which followed a heavy 6-1 defeat to Accrington Stanley, has seen the Gas drop to 20th in League One, outside the drop only on goal difference.

Only four teams in the division have scored more than Oxford this season, while only one side have scored fewer than Bristol Rovers.

Mide Shodipo took his goal tally to ten in Saturday and Robinson gave starts to deadline day signings Brandon Barker and Elliot Lee.

For the Gas, Brandon Hanlan has scored eight goals but hasn’t found the net since January 2, while Sam Nicholson has scored seven in all competitions. However, goals in the league have been hard to come by with just 24 from 25 matches for the club.

The win over Rovers last month was a first in six meetings for Oxford. The U’s have now won just three from the last 14 encounters between the two sides.
